None of these enzymes are real. Not one has ever been expressed, crystallised, assayed, or observed. There is no organism they came from, because those organisms do not exist either.
How they are generated. Everything you see is produced in your browser, procedurally, from a single number. A seeded pseudo-random sequence assembles a plausible backbone out of helices, strands and loops. The same sequence names the enzyme in a binomial-adjacent style, invents an Enzyme Commission number, fabricates a source organism, assigns a substrate, writes a one-sentence function, and predicts a mass. The rotating figure is a cartoon of that backbone. The downloadable .pdb file contains the very same coordinates, formatted to look like a deposited structure. It will open in real structural-biology software. It describes nothing.
What that says about structure prediction. Generative structure prediction has turned protein folds into an aesthetic commodity — ribbon diagrams as wallpaper, model outputs as desktop backgrounds. After a few minutes of scrolling gorgeous, plausible enzymes that will never exist, the point arrives on its own: a great deal of generated biology is now visually indistinguishable from catalogued biology, and a database of predicted structures is a catalogue of confident guesses, not a catalogue of things that are known to be true. A predicted structure is a hypothesis wearing the clothes of a measurement.
Where we drew the line. This piece stays firmly on the enzyme side — metabolic enzymes, structural proteins, luciferases, extremophile oddities. No toxins, no virulence factors, nothing pathogen-shaped, and no sequence-level design guidance of any kind. The beauty here is in catalysis and folding, not in threat, and that is both the responsible line and the better-looking one.
This toy is the descendant of the Infinite Discovery Machine, which Sebastian Cocioba has been building for years at Binomica Labs. That project is the direct ancestor of everything on this page.
We do not homage it; we co-author it. The collaboration is what lets the generated structures be plausible rather than merely decorative — which is the whole difference between a novelty and a provocation.
